Calculator application using python

from tkinter import* | |
def iCalc(source, side): | |
storeObj = Frame(source, borderwidth=1, bd=4,bg="powder blue") | |
storeObj.pack(side=side, expand=YES, fill=BOTH) | |
return storeObj | |
def button(source, side, text, command=None): | |
storeObj = Button(source, text=text, command=command) | |
storeObj.pack(side=side, expand=YES, fill=BOTH) | |
return storeObj | |
class app(Frame): | |
def __init__(self): | |
Frame.__init__(self) | |
self.option_add('*Font', 'arial 20 bold') | |
self.pack(expand=YES, fill=BOTH) | |
self.master.title('Techy tech calculator') | |
display = StringVar() | |
Entry(self, relief=RAISED, | |
textvariable=display,justify='right',bd=30,bg="powder blue").pack(side=TOP, expand=YES, | |
fill=BOTH) | |
for clearBut in (["CE"],["Clear"]): | |
erase = iCalc(self,TOP) | |
for ichar in clearBut: | |
button(erase,LEFT,ichar, | |
lambda storeObj=display, q=ichar: storeObj.set('')) | |
for NumBut in ("789/", "456*", "123-", "0.+"): | |
FunctionNum = iCalc(self,TOP) | |
for iEquals in NumBut: | |
button(FunctionNum, LEFT, iEquals, | |
lambda storeObj=display, q=iEquals: storeObj.set(storeObj.get()+q)) | |
EqualsButton = iCalc(self,TOP) | |
for iEquals in "=": | |
if iEquals == '=': | |
btniEquals = button(EqualsButton, LEFT,iEquals) | |
btniEquals.bind('<ButtonRelease-1>', | |
lambda e, s=self, storeObj=display: s.calc(storeObj), '+') | |
else: | |
btniEquals = button(EqualsButton, LEFT, iEquals, | |
lambda storeObj=display, s=' %s ' %iEquals: storeObj.set(storeObj.get()+s)) | |
def calc(self, display): | |
try: | |
display.set(eval(display.get())) | |
except: | |
display.set("ERROR") | |
if __name__=='__main__': | |
app().mainloop() |
